The Annual Revenant Hunt- a Tales of Horror adventure
« on: 29 October 2021, 03:08:53 PM »
“You are cordially invited to this year’s event of the season. The Annual Revenant Hunt and Fundraiser for St Agatha’s Home for Unfortunate Children. It‘s that time of year again!
The dead have risen and the best Hunters from around the world have gathered to hunt them down and return them permanently to the grave.”
Things started out well for the hunters. Few zombies were appearing, and those that did were easily dispatched. But then, something changed in the air. Zombies were appearing it seemed everywhere. With a screeching sound of rusty cemetery gates, a great beast made of gravestones and tombs appeared!
